The Challenges of WasteWater
Waste water management often faces two significant issues: odour and sludge build-up. These problems not only affect the quality and usability of water but also pose challenges to surrounding environments and communities.
-
Odour Control: EM™ plays a pivotal role in eliminating bad odours from waste water. Initially, it rapidly suppresses unpleasant smells. As the microbial activity restores the waste water system to a natural biological function, these odours are significantly reduced.
-
Sludge Reduction: Over time, EM™ helps decrease sludge build-up, transforming waste water into a clearer, higher-quality resource. This improved water can often be safely applied to land and crops, enhancing the sustainability of agricultural practices.
Practical Applications of EM™
-
Pond Restoration: Adding EM™ to ponds can improve water clarity and health by breaking down organic matter. This reduces sludge and odours while promoting a balanced ecosystem, making water fit again for flora and fauna.
-
Septic Systems: Applying EM™ to septic tanks helps in the biological waste treatment, decomposing organic waste naturally. This not only controls odour but also minimises sludge accumulation, resulting in a more efficient and longer-lasting system.
